UP AND UNDER pulled nicely clear of the rest when touched off by White Birch in the C&D Ballysax Stakes last month and, with the promise of more to come from this well-bred and unexposed colt, he is taken to go one better this time. Proud And Regal did nothing wrong during his 2-y-o campaign and will offer stern resistance if ready to roll on this seasonal reappearance. The Aidan O'Brien-trained duo Londoner and Tower of London should both be in the mix, while Sprewell is also accorded respect.
